Sqlserver
 sql >> डेटाबेस >  >> RDS >> Sqlserver

दूसरे कॉलम के रूप में DISTINCT कॉलम की डुप्लिकेट पंक्तियों की संख्या कैसे प्राप्त करें?

COUNT() का उपयोग करें MakeDistinct . को समूहीकृत करके कार्य करें GROUP BY . का उपयोग करके कॉलम खंड।

  SELECT MakeDistinct AS AfterDistinct
       , COUNT(MakeDistinct) AS Count
    FROM MyTable
GROUP BY MakeDistinct

आउटपुट:

╔═══════════════╦═══════╗
║ AFTERDISTINCT ║ COUNT ║
╠═══════════════╬═══════╣
║ CAT           ║     3 ║
║ DOG           ║     2 ║
║ PIN           ║     4 ║
╚═══════════════╩═══════╝

यह SQLFiddle देखें



  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. SQL सर्वर (T-SQL) में फ़ोन नंबर प्रारूपित करें

  2. SQL सर्वर में एक अस्थायी तालिका में संग्रहीत कार्यविधि के परिणाम कैसे सम्मिलित करें

  3. क्वेरी बैच में 'क्रिएट व्यू' पहला स्टेटमेंट होना चाहिए

  4. SQL सर्वर:संबंध बनाने में असमर्थ

  5. एसक्यूएल सर्वर में डबल का प्रतिनिधित्व क्या करता है?